X-Plane 10.20+ Voisin Type 3 LA. The Voisin III was a French two-seat bomber and ground attack aircraft of World War I, one of the first of its kind. It is also notable for being the first aircraft in the war to win an aerial fight and shoot down an enemy aircraft. It was a pusher biplane, developed by Voisin in 1914 as a more powerful version of the 1912 Voisin I design.
